Alvaro Surname Meaning

Spanish and Portuguese (Álvaro); Italian: from the personal name Álvaro Alvaro which is of ancient Germanic (Visigothic) origin but the exact etymology is not clear.

Source: Dictionary of American Family Names 2nd edition, 2022

Where is the Alvaro family from?

You can see how Alvaro families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Alvaro family name was found in the USA, and Canada between 1880 and 1920. The most Alvaro families were found in USA in 1920. In 1911 there were 4 Alvaro families living in British Columbia. This was 100% of all the recorded Alvaro's in Canada. British Columbia had the highest population of Alvaro families in 1911.

What did your Alvaro ancestors do for a living?

In 1940, Laborer and Maid were the top reported jobs for men and women in the USA named Alvaro. 69% of Alvaro men worked as a Laborer and 43% of Alvaro women worked as a Maid. Some less common occupations for Americans named Alvaro were Proprietor and Packer.

What is the average Alvaro lifespan?

Between 1958 and 2004, in the United States, Alvaro life expectancy was at its lowest point in 1969, and highest in 1985. The average life expectancy for Alvaro in 1958 was 40, and 74 in 2004.
